“Suzanne Marie” Lyrics Meaning

From the opening line, “Time has passed, the minutes seem like hours,” we’re plunged into a world of reflection and nostalgia. The singer feels the weight of time, emphasizing how the moments drag on since they last walked beside Suzanne Marie.

The following lines, “I call your name in darkness, as I wander through the night, people wonder who I call Suzanne Marie,” further dive into the singer’s longing. They are caught in a moment of solitude, calling out to Suzanne Marie, lost in their thoughts and memories.

The chorus brings a sense of confession and vulnerability, “I’d like to see you soon again and tell you, to my heart you hold the only key.” The singer expresses a deep desire to reunite and share their feelings, highlighting Suzanne Marie’s unique place in their heart.

The following verses show the singer’s journey, “As I walk through all these lonely places, each corner I see your face again.” Every step and turn brings memories of Suzanne Marie, showcasing the profound impact she has left on the singer’s life.

The lines “And your face it brings back memories, that I just can’t forget, so I’m coming back to you Suzanne Marie,” reveal a determination to reconnect and rekindle what was lost. The singer is haunted by the past, driven by the hope of a second chance.

In the bridge, “My thoughts no matter what, revolve around her, I hope she knows she means the world to me,” the singer lays it all on the line, emphasizing the central role Suzanne Marie plays in their thoughts and life.

The song concludes with a promise, “And when and if I have to choose a girl to share my life, I promise it will be Suzanne Marie.” The singer is certain of their feelings, ready to commit and hoping for a future with Suzanne Marie.
